Many will have questioned the difference between contouring product and a bronzer. While a bronzer is typically used to warm the face and add a sunkissed glow to the skin, a contouring product will be used to define and sculpt the face. Note that since some bronzers come with light-reflecting particles that give a shimmery or glittery appearance to the skin, these should be avoided if your purpose is contouring. Instead, look for formulas that are completely matte; you want the contour to look like your own skin instead of an unnatural shimmer.

The beauty of cream contour products is the believable finish they impart. Powder formulas tend to mattify your complexion, whereas cream ones mimic the texture of your skin, creating believable shadows wherever you blend them.
